The Porsche 911, produced between 1970 and 1973, represents a significant era for this iconic sports car, embodying the classic long-wheelbase design before the introduction of impact bumpers. These models, built with Porsche's renowned engineering quality, are celebrated for their rear-engine, rear-wheel-drive layout, air-cooled flat-six engines, and exceptional driver engagement. Available in various configurations such as the T, E, S, and the highly sought-after Carrera RS, they offered a pure driving experience that set them apart from competitors and solidified Porsche's reputation for performance and reliability.
